My name is Lucy, and I want to tell you about my grandmother, Rosa. She is eighty years old, but she is always busy! She never sits still for long.
Every morning, Rosa always gets up at six o'clock. She usually makes tea and reads the newspaper in the garden. After breakfast, she often walks to the market to buy fresh vegetables. She says fresh food is important for a long, healthy life.
In the afternoon, Rosa sometimes visits her friend Maria. They often play cards and talk about their families. On other days, she stays at home and paints small pictures of flowers. She is a good artist, but she never sells her paintings. She just gives them to her family and friends.
Rosa rarely watches television, but she sometimes listens to the radio in the evening. She loves old music from the 1960s. Once a week, on Sundays, she cooks a big dinner for the whole family. My cousins and I always help her in the kitchen because we love spending time with her.
Last week, Rosa did something new. She usually stays close to home, but she decided to visit the city for the first time in ten years! She was very excited and took lots of photos. I hope she does it again soon. She always says, 'Life is short, so enjoy every day!'
